Introduction to Quantum Healthcare

Quantum healthcare is an emerging field that combines the principles of quantum mechanics with healthcare to develop innovative solutions for disease diagnosis, treatment, and prevention. The integration of quantum computing and artificial intelligence (AI) has the potential to revolutionise the healthcare industry, enabling faster and more accurate diagnosis, personalised treatment, and improved patient outcomes. According to a report by ResearchAndMarkets.com, the global quantum healthcare market is expected to reach $1.4 billion by 2027, growing at a compound annual growth rate (CAGR) of 22.1% during the forecast period (2020-2027) [1].
